## Runbook: Hushgate Alert Deduplicator

Heads up, reviewer: Hushgate sits between our monitors and the pager, collapsing duplicate alerts into a single incident within a sliding window. If it falls over, on-call gets the firehose, so treat changes here carefully. Key behaviors: dedupe keys are hashed from alert source plus fingerprint, the window is tunable per severity, and suppressed alerts still land in the audit stream. When reviewing, check the window math against these values, since the current production configuration is listed below.

deployment values, faduf-tawep:
SORDOR_LOG_LEVEL=error
SORDOR_METRICS_HOST=metrics.sordor.nelvrolabs.internal
SORDOR_POOL_SIZE=4

## Add log sampling to Chatterwell ingest workers

Chatterwell's ingest workers emit roughly one log line per message processed, which at current volume is drowning the pipeline and inflating storage costs. This PR introduces probabilistic sampling on INFO-level lines, with errors and warnings always kept. Sampling decisions are made per worker using a stable hash, so a given request's lines are either all kept or all dropped — easier to debug that way. Rates are configurable via env vars but ship with the defaults tabled below.

tuning table, kajog-kawef:
PRIORITIES = {
    "kelox": 870,
    "kasix": 89,
    "eliax": 988,
}

**Leadership Review Briefing – Tollgate Pilot Churn**

For sales leads. Churn in the Tollgate pilot hit 14% last month, double forecast. Exit interviews point to onboarding friction, not pricing. Retention offers recovered six accounts; nine remain at risk. Fix underway: revised onboarding flow ships in two weeks. Renewal conversations should pause until then unless the customer initiates. Targets for the quarter are unchanged pending review. One strategic item is appended below; do not circulate it.

management briefing: Project Ulavan slips by two quarters because of the staffing delay.